Comparison FAQs

What is the biggest difference between the Arizer Air and the OG E-Nano?

The biggest practical difference is form factor: these aren't the same kind of device. Arizer Air is a portable, OG E-Nano is a desktop. Pick based on whether you want something portable or something stationary.

Which is cheaper, the Arizer Air or the OG E-Nano?

Arizer Air is the cheaper option at $110 compared with $200 for the OG E-Nano, about $90 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.

Is the Arizer Air or the OG E-Nano better for home versus on-the-go use?

Arizer Air is the take-anywhere choice. It's a portable, battery-powered unit, while the OG E-Nano is built for home use, where bigger heaters, AC power, and larger chambers make sense.
